Vinglas nr. 15 Drikkeglas Berlinois is the rough versionHeight 11 cm. The glass is from the 1860s. The glass is mouth blown with a spherical sand navel at the bottom. It is finely ground with a tongue cut around the cuppa and has an inverted baluster shaped stem with a clear mollex between the glass and stem. The glass appears in Holmegaard's catalog 1853, as "Wine glass no. 15". Later, the shape of the glass was used as the basic shape for an entire glass series together with "Madera glass no. 9".
